NIFT Registrar R K Sharma told Business Standard that the survey and documentation process had already been completed and reports prepared.
"We have completed the documentation for all the major crafts of UP, such as chikan work of Lucknow, Banarasi silk work of Varanasi, brassware of Moradabad and stone carving of Agra," he said.
The survey was done by the first-year students of the institute as a part of their project. They visited the geographical clusters for these crafts and met the artisans and other stake holders to document the history of these arts and present status.
The next step will be to select two of these famous crafts after thorough discussion and brainstorming, which needs to be protected and patented.
